InsideOut Selects Metromedia for Co-location and Optical IP
📅 - InsideOut Technologies, Inc. (insideouttech.com), a provider of intelligent electronic business networks and services, has selected Metromedia Fiber Network, Inc. (mmfn.com) to provide co-location services and an optical IP network to support its Web-based infrastructure and client services.
InsideOut will use MFN's Internet Service Exchange facility in McLean, Va., to host InsideOut's business networks. The three-year agreement with MFN allows InsideOut to provide consistent site performance and the highest level of security for its growing customer base; financial services institutions, insurance and telecom enterprises that need a protected, highly efficient system for accepting and transmitting sensitive data from multiple sources.
InsideOut selected MFN because of its high security standards, including multiple levels of redundancy in an effort to withstand natural disasters, security breaches (physical and cyber), power outages, and networking and computing failures. Features include a superior cooling system, an advanced Continuous
Power Supply system that protects against degraded commercial power and interruptions, a Very Early Smoke Detection Alarm, biometric authentication, and round-the-clock surveillance.
Additionally, InsideOut says it was impressed with MFN's global optical IP backbone, which can transport large amounts of data at terabit speed with virtually unlimited bandwidth capacity.
"The advanced security measures within MFN's ISX facilities, combined with the scalability and redundancy of our IP infrastructure, will allow InsideOut to create a reliable online network for credit and risk management related transactions," said Mark Spagnolo, president of MFN Internet Solutions.
